Synthesis of the rarely obtained syn-Adducts in the Reaction of Organocopper Compounds with 2,3-O-Isopropylideneglyceraldehyde. Preparation of Optically Active Epoxy Alcohols
Sato, Fumie,Kobayashi, Yuichi,Takahashi, Osamu,Chiba, Tsunehisa,Takeda, Yoshiyuki,Kusakabe, Masato
, p. 1636 - 1638 (2007/10/02)
Organocopper compounds, prepared from Grignard reagents and copper(I) iodide in tetrahydrofuran-dimethyl sulphide, react with 2,3-O-isopropylideneglyceraldehyde highly stereoselectively (>10:1) affording the rarely obtained syn-addition products which can be readily converted into optically active epoxy alcohols, useful intermediates in organic synthesis.
